Announcing Accelerator's Day One Emcees: Dean McCall and Tim Street!

McCall-Dean.jpgOn March 15 at the Hilton Austin Downtown, 32 companies will do their best to dazzle a live audience and panel of judges with ideas, innovations, and products that provide a glimpse into the future of technology. By March 16, after an intense and inspiring free-for-all, only 12 will stand a chance at capturing the attention of the industry and all that comes with it. And only four will emerge as Microsoft BizSpark Accelerator at SXSW Interactive 2010 champions.

200px-TimStreet2009.JPGKnock'em-down-drag'em-out battles like this need referees, right? Commentators to call the action? Emcees who can entertain? Well, we're happy to announce that we have four -- for our announcement of Day Two emcees Chris Sacca and Brad King, click here -- and today we're ready to tell you about two more of them ...

Dean McCall and Tim Street will host Day One of Accelerator at SXSW, and we couldn't be more excited.

McCall is the CEO and founder of Ideagin, LLC, a serial entrepreneur and a catalyst in the Texas technology community. McCall is an Entrepreneur in Residence at UTSA’s Center for Innovation and Entrepreneurship and sits on the boards of various technology organizations. He is also the President of the Idea Finishing School, a Texas startup accelerator, and a Venture Advisor to DFJ Mercury.

Street is a web video pioneer, writer, producer, director, and new media consultant. He co-hosts This Week in Media and is the creator/executive producer the popular video series French Maid TV.
